Manager, Procurement

Burlington
Posted 1 weeks ago
🇺🇸United States🏢Hybrid💰$95.0K–$125.0K📁Operations & Admin
Is this job info correct?

Position Overview As a key leader of medium-to-large sized indirect spend categories, the Manager Procurement - Corporate is accountable for the development and implementation of robust sourcing strategies that link to core business deliverables while leveraging the marketplace and supplier community. They will perform end to end strategic sourcing and category management functions: analyzing third party spend to identify opportunities, integrating category strategies, and executing the sourcing process (including but not limited to RFx, negotiations, contracting activities). They will develop relationships and provide strategic category direction to business partners and cross functional teams. This person will work across other pyramids to drive value and provides guidance as well as ensure adherence to procurement processes and policy compliance across the enterprise. A Day in the Life Major Duties and Responsibilities: Create and implement sourcing strategy for medium-to-large sized categories, including managing the sourcing (RFx, RFI, RFP, reverse auction, negotiations) and evaluations processes, using appropriate support tools to drive results and deliver savings Develop and execute sourcing strategies and events for assigned spend areas (Finance, HR, IT Corporate Systems, Legal, Marketing, and Strategy), including managing contract negotiation process (pricing, key terms, etc.) and measuring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) and other performance metrics Perform advanced analysis to support the Procurement and Sourcing process, e.g., understanding current potential savings opportunities, pricing models, and scenarios Maintain and manage existing contracts as well as the contract review process using contract management software, Coupa Interface with relevant business partners (VP, Director, and Manager levels) for procurement support, including jointly setting procurement priorities and executing continuous cost and performance improvement strategies Maintain regular communication with suppliers and work collaboratively to resolve ongoing issues and to promote continuous improvement/cost reductions on a proactive basis Supervision: 1 Direct report. You'll Come With Bachelors Degree in Supply Chain, Accounting, Finance or Business. MBA is a plus. 5-7 years of experience of indirect procurement or similar analytical role (finance, IT, merchandising, planning) At least 3 years of vendor management or contract management/negotiation Firm understanding of procurement best practices and emerging trends Certified Purchasing Manager (CPM) is a plus Certified Purchasing Professional (CPP) is a plus Certified Professional Purchasing Consultant (CPPC) is a plus Certified Project Management Professional (PMP) is a plus A strong understanding of negotiation techniques, strategies, and possesses the skills required to execute An in-depth knowledge of the sourcing process Must have a strong command and understanding of fundamental analytical techniques, and has the ability to accurately draw conclusions and interpret data Experience with managing high value (multi-million dollar), high visibility sourcing initiatives Demonstrated contract negotiation experience across a range of services and commodities Experience with interpreting and drafting contractual terms Experience with developing and implementing successful cost saving initiatives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with a keen understanding of relevant cost drivers Demonstrated ability to lead teams in achieving or beating challenging goals Procurement systems knowledge, specifically Coupa, is a plus #LI-CG1 Come join our team.
